Get ready for a little bit of Broadway in your backyard this winter because the Radio City Christmas Spectacular, starring the Rockettes, is coming to D.C. for the first time ever this December. The high-kicking holiday hit will be at the Patriot Center in Fairfax, Va., on December 15 and 16; and at the Verizon Center in Washington, D.C., December 18-20.

Tickets for the Radio City Christmas Spectacular at the Patriot Center and Verizon Center are $79.50 and $52.50 (plus applicable service charges). Tickets will go on sale to the general public in mid-September and they can be bought using the traditional Ticketmaster outlets.
